def apply_repetition_penalties_torch(
    logits: torch.Tensor,
    prompt_mask: torch.Tensor,
    output_mask: torch.Tensor,
    repetition_penalties: torch.Tensor,
) -> None:
    repetition_penalties = repetition_penalties.unsqueeze(dim=1).repeat(
        1, logits.size(1)
    )
    # If token appears in prompt or output, apply, otherwise use 1.0 for no-op.
    penalties = torch.where(prompt_mask | output_mask, repetition_penalties, 1.0)
    # If logits are positive, divide by penalty, otherwise multiply by penalty.
    scaling = torch.where(logits > 0, 1.0 / penalties, penalties)
    logits *= scaling


def apply_repetition_penalties_cuda(
    logits: torch.Tensor,
    prompt_mask: torch.Tensor,
    output_mask: torch.Tensor,
    repetition_penalties: torch.Tensor,
) -> None:
    torch.ops._C.apply_repetition_penalties_(
        logits, prompt_mask, output_mask, repetition_penalties
    )


def apply_repetition_penalties(
    logits: torch.Tensor,
    prompt_mask: torch.Tensor,
    output_mask: torch.Tensor,
    repetition_penalties: torch.Tensor,
) -> None:
    """Apply repetition penalties to logits in-place.

    Args:
        logits: The logits tensor of shape [num_seqs, vocab_size].
        prompt_mask: A boolean tensor indicating which tokens appear in the prompt.
        output_mask: A boolean tensor indicating which tokens appear in the output.
        repetition_penalties: The repetition penalties of shape (num_seqs, ).
    """
    if logits.is_cuda and logits.is_contiguous():
        apply_repetition_penalties_cuda(
            logits, prompt_mask, output_mask, repetition_penalties
        )
    else:
        apply_repetition_penalties_torch(
            logits, prompt_mask, output_mask, repetition_penalties
        )

def cutlass_scaled_mm(
    a: torch.Tensor,
    b: torch.Tensor,
    scale_a: torch.Tensor,
    scale_b: torch.Tensor,
    out_dtype: torch.dtype,
    bias: torch.Tensor | None = None,
) -> torch.Tensor:
    """
    `cutlass_scaled_mm` implements a fused version of
        `output = torch.mm((scale_a * a), (scale_b * b)).to(out_dtype)`
    where scale_a * a and scale_b * b are implemented using numpy-style
    broadcasting.

    In order to support blockwise scaling like found in DeepSeek V3 we also
    support extended "group" broadcast rules. We extend the numpy-style
    broadcasting rules with the following rule:
        "if the extent of a dimension in the source shape is between 1 and
        corresponding extent in the target shape we repeat each element along
        that dimension  src_shape[dim] // target_shape[dim] times consecutively"
    example if we have:
          a = [[1, 2], and target_shape = (2, 4)
               [3, 4]]
    then we would expand a to:
          a = [[1, 1, 2, 2],
               [3, 3, 4, 4]]
    currently we only support the case:
        scale_a.shape * [1, 128] == a.shape
        scale_b.shape * [128, 128] == b.shape
    """
    assert out_dtype is torch.bfloat16 or out_dtype is torch.float16
    assert bias is None or bias.numel() == b.shape[1] and bias.dtype == out_dtype

    # Massage the input to be 2D
    target_shape = (*a.shape[:-1], b.shape[1])
    a = a.view(-1, a.shape[-1])

    cutlass_compatible_b = b.shape[0] % 16 == 0 and b.shape[1] % 16 == 0
    if current_platform.is_rocm() or not cutlass_compatible_b:
        from vllm.model_executor.layers.quantization.compressed_tensors.triton_scaled_mm import (  # noqa
            triton_scaled_mm,
        )

        out = triton_scaled_mm(a, b, scale_a, scale_b, out_dtype, bias)
    else:
        out = torch.empty((a.shape[0], b.shape[1]), dtype=out_dtype, device=a.device)
        torch.ops._C.cutlass_scaled_mm(out, a, b, scale_a, scale_b, bias)

    return out.view(*target_shape)

def cutlass_sparse_compress(a: torch.Tensor) -> tuple[torch.Tensor, torch.Tensor]:
    """
    Compresses a sparse matrix for use with Cutlass sparse operations.

    This function takes a dense tensor and compresses it into two components:
    non-zero elements and metadata. The compressed representation is compatible
    with Cutlass sparse kernels.

    Args:
        a (torch.Tensor):
            The input tensor to be compressed. Must have one of the following data types:
            - `torch.int8`
            - `torch.float8_e4m3fn`
            - `torch.bfloat16`
            - `torch.float16`

    Returns:
        tuple[torch.Tensor, torch.Tensor]:
            A tuple containing:
            - `a_nzs` (torch.Tensor): A tensor containing non-zero elements of `a`.
            - `a_meta` (torch.Tensor): A tensor containing metadata for the sparse representation.

    Raises:
        ValueError: If the compression operation fails.

    Notes:
        - The `a_meta` tensor has a data type of `torch.uint8`.
        - Each metadata element encodes the sparsity of 4 non-zero elements (i.e., `elemsPerMetaElem = 4`).
        - The shape of `a_nzs` is `(m, k // 2)`, where `m` and `k` are the dimensions of the input tensor.
        - The shape of `a_meta` is `(m, k // 2 // elemsPerMetaElem)`.
    """
    assert a.dtype in [torch.int8, torch.float8_e4m3fn, torch.bfloat16, torch.float16]
    assert a.is_contiguous()

    # a_meta.dtype: torch.uint8 so elemsPerMetaElem = 8b / 2b_per_nz = 4
    elemsPerMetaElem = 4
    assert a.shape[1] % (2 * elemsPerMetaElem) == 0

    return torch.ops._C.cutlass_sparse_compress(a)

def scaled_fp4_quant(
    input: torch.Tensor,
    input_global_scale: torch.Tensor,
    is_sf_swizzled_layout: bool = True,
    backend: str = "none",
) -> tuple[torch.Tensor, torch.Tensor]:
    """
    Quantize input tensor to FP4 and return quantized tensor and scale.

    This function quantizes the last dimension of the given tensor `input`. For
    every 16 consecutive elements, a single dynamically computed scaling factor
    is shared. This scaling factor is quantized using the `input_global_scale`
    and is stored in a swizzled layout (see
    https://docs.nvidia.com/cuda/parallel-thread-execution/#tcgen05-mma-scale-factor-b-layout-4x).

    Args:
        input: The input tensor to be quantized to FP4
        input_global_scale: A scalar scaling factor for the entire tensor.
        use_8x4_sf_layout: Whether to use the 8x4 or 128x4 layout for the scaling

    Returns:
        tuple[torch.Tensor, torch.Tensor]: The output tensor in FP4 but every
            two values are packed into a uint8 and float8_e4m3 scaling factors
            in the sizzled layout.
    """
    assert not current_platform.is_rocm()
    assert input.ndim >= 1, f"input.ndim needs to be >= 1, but got {input.ndim}."
    other_dims = 1 if input.ndim == 1 else -1
    input = input.reshape(other_dims, input.shape[-1])
    m, n = input.shape
    block_size = 16
    device = input.device

    assert n % block_size == 0, f"last dim has to be multiple of 16, but got {n}."
    assert input.dtype in (torch.float16, torch.bfloat16), (
        f"input.dtype needs to be fp16 or bf16 but got {input.dtype}."
    )

    use_8x4_sf_layout = True if "trtllm" in backend and m <= 32 else False  # noqa: SIM210

    if use_8x4_sf_layout:
        output, output_scale = flashinfer_quant_nvfp4_8x4_sf_layout(
            input, input_global_scale
        )
    else:
        # Two fp4 values will be packed into an uint8.
        output = torch.empty((m, n // 2), device=device, dtype=torch.uint8)
        if is_sf_swizzled_layout:
            # We use the rounded values to store the swizzled values. Due to the
            # requirement of the Tensor Core, the minimum tile is 128x4 for the scales.
            # So, we first pad the scales to multiples of 128 and 4. Then, the scales
            # (in float8_e4m3fn) are packed into an int32 for every 4 values. More:
            # https://docs.nvidia.com/cuda/parallel-thread-execution/#tcgen05-mma-scale-factor-b-layout-4x
            round_up = lambda x, y: (x + y - 1) // y * y
            rounded_m = round_up(m, 128)
            scale_n = n // block_size
            rounded_n = round_up(scale_n, 4)
            output_scale = torch.empty(
                (rounded_m, rounded_n // 4), device=device, dtype=torch.int32
            )
        else:
            output_scale = torch.empty((m, n // 16), device=device, dtype=torch.uint8)

        torch.ops._C.scaled_fp4_quant(
            output, input, output_scale, input_global_scale, is_sf_swizzled_layout
        )

    output_scale = output_scale.view(torch.float8_e4m3fn)
    return output, output_scale

def swap_blocks(
    src: torch.Tensor,
    dst: torch.Tensor,
    block_size_in_bytes: int,
    block_mapping: torch.Tensor,
) -> None:
    """
    Copy specific blocks from one tensor to another.

    This method assumes each of the two input tensors is composed of
    consecutive contiguous blocks, of size block_size_in_bytes.
    i.e. the memory layout for each tensor is:
    [block0] [block1] ... [block N]

    block_mapping determines the subset of blocks to copy of the source tensor,
    and their matching destination block number on the destination tensor.
    block_mapping is expected to be a tensor of shape (num_blocks_to_copy, 2)
    where each block_mapping[i] represents a single copy operation, copying
    block #block_mapping[i][0] from the source tensor
    to block #block_mapping[i][1] on the destination tensor.
    block_mapping should have dtype int64.

    The source and the destination tensors can be either on cpu or gpu,
    but not both on cpu.
    the block mapping tensor must on cpu.
    """
    torch.ops._C_cache_ops.swap_blocks(src, dst, block_size_in_bytes, block_mapping)
